What is Ballet Fusion?

Ballet Fusion is for adults only. We work through ballet exercises that have been adapted to focus on fitness, strength, toning, improved posture and balance. All the exercises are based on the traditional principles of classical ballet but we’ve modified them to make them safe, more impactful and more appropriate for adults. We’ve also thrown in some new moves and additional core work to really help posture and balance. Something nearly all of us could do with!

Unlike traditional ballet classes or children’s classes, we won’t ask you to do anything on your own while the rest of the class watch, we won’t single you out and we won’t ask you to perform any embarrassing or complicated moves. We encourage attendees to listen to their bodies and won’t ask you to do anything which feels uncomfortable or painful.

Focus is on fun, friendly and challenging but achievable movements which will benefit you in the best possible ways.

Who is Ballet Fusion for?

Ballet Fusion is for everyone! We welcome people who have never done ballet before, people who did ballet as a child and dancers from all backgrounds and experience levels. Al levels join the same class, as exercises are designed to work for everyone. Your teacher may modify movements to increase or decrease difficulty depending upon you and the wider class but even the most simple of exercises are hugely beneficial and will leave you with that lovely burn which means you’ve worked those muscles brilliantly!

Why is Ballet Fusion / adult ballet so good for you?

Great question! We all know that ballerinas have super strong physiques but there’s much more to it than strength and a slim frame. Ballet Fusion can dramatically help many things:

  • Tone, strengthen & lengthen muscles

  • Increase flexibility

  • Improve posture & balance

  • Improve lymph drainage

  • Improve balance & core strength

  • Strengthen pelvic floor muscles

  • Increase brain stimulation, focus & relieve stress

Is Ballet Fusion safe?

Yes. Whilst classical ballet is generally quite safe, there are a few moves and positions which can be a little more dangerous for adults - especially for those with old or underlying injuries or weaknesses. Ballet Fusion aims to avoid chance of injury and maintain safe positions and movements which will strengthen muscles and related joint support.

What if I have current or old injuries?

It’s really important that you inform your instructor of any old or current injuries you have - especially knee, hip or ankle issues. Having said that, many of our exercises will be great for promoting the healing of older injuries and increasing muscle strength around joints. Just make sure you let your instructor know and don’t continue if any moves hurt or twist your joints.

It’s absolutely fine to skip an exercise if you feel uncertain or uncomfortable and we encourage attendees to take a break at any time.
